Welcome to the Early Childhood Resource Center housed in the Children's Room at the Central Branch of the Springfield City Library! For more about the resources available for the Early Childhood community, click here.

The Early Childhood Resource Center (ECRC) is funded by the Massachusetts Department of Early Education and Care (DECC). The ECRC consists of books and other resources especially appropriate for teachers and caregivers working with young children. The only thing you need to borrow these resources is a library card! All ECRC materials can be found by searching our library catalog. You can use the catalog as usual or try one of these special searches:

To see a list of all the materials, including books, in the ECRC collection do the following (or simply click on the links below):

Click on the Library Catalog link.
Under Other Searches, choose Number Searches.
Click on the Music Number tab.
Type ECRC in the search box.
A full list of ECRC materials will appear.

To get a list of puzzles, toys, puppets, kits, or equipment:

Click on the Library Catalog link.
Under Other Searches, choose Number Searches.
Click on the Dewey Call Number tab.
Type one of the following in the search box:

*J ECRC kit
*Jequip
*Jmanip
*Jpuppet
*Jpuzzle
*Jtoy

You will retrieve items from any Library that uses these call numbers. Note that the puzzles link will find other puzzle items not a part of ECRC.
ECRC puzzles will be tagged Springfield Main Juv ECRC.
